Castle Hayne is a charming postal city that offers a calm and peaceful atmosphere with low traffic noise throughout most areas. The community is characterized by a diverse range of housing options, including primarily single detached homes and some mobile homes, providing a variety of choices in home sizes. The majority of buildings were established around 1988, giving the area a well-maintained and cohesive appearance. Residents benefit from convenient access to major highways like US Highway 17, facilitating easy travel by vehicle. The landscape features gentle slopes, making any use of bicycling comfortable. This location supports a tranquil, relaxed living setting ideal for quiet enjoyment.
The character of Castle Hayne is exemplified by its calm environment. The noise levels in Castle Hayne are very low, as the streets are usually very peaceful.
Parks, schools, dining, and what makes this neighborhood special
This expansive county park sits just off Castle Hayne Road at the heart of the Blossom Ferry area and offers paved walking and bike-friendly trails, playgrounds, disc golf, picnic spots, and sports facilities—ideal for family outings and active residents.
Located on Roger Haynes Drive, this well-regarded local school grounds Blossom Ferry in a strong educational community and hosts frequent family‑oriented events such as STEAM Night and reading fundraisers.
Nestled along the Northeast Cape Fear River just across from Blossom Ferry Road, Riverside Park offers a peaceful gazebo, non‑motorized boat launch for kayaking or fishing, and scenic riverside access popular with locals.
Just minutes from Blossom Ferry, this equestrian facility provides horseback riding opportunities throughout wooded trails and open fields, giving residents a unique rural recreational option.
This purpose‑built mountain bike park nearby features challenging off‑road trails through forested terrain, making it a favorite for Blossom Ferry thrill‑seekers and trail‑riding enthusiasts.
